Overview
John Quincy Archibald is a father and husband whose son is diagnosed with an enlarged heart and then finds out he cannot receive a transplant because HMO insurance will not cover it. Therefore, he decides to take a hospital full of patients hostage until the hospital puts his son's name on the donor's list.

What makes this movie Worth Watching
Released in 2002, 'John Q' came during a time of increasing debate over healthcare reform in the United States. The movie serves as a reflection of public concerns about affordable and accessible care.
- Denzel Washington delivers a powerhouse performance as the desperate father, John Quincy Archibald.
- The movie tackles compelling themes of healthcare system flaws, family struggles, and moral dilemmas.
- The plot keeps viewers engaged with its suspenseful hospital hostage situation.
- The film offers a poignant examination of the human cost of America's healthcare crisis.
